TUDOR WATCHES Honouring the brand's first dive watch Watch variations (2) Black Bay 31/36/39/41 A sophisticated vision of the Black Bay aesthetic The traveller's Black Bay The adventurers' Black Bay Blending aquatic and motorsport heritage A tribute to the 1950s Tudor divers' watches Gradient matt "brown-bronze" dial Montres Tudor SA, or simply Tudor, is a Swiss watchmaker based in Geneva, Switzerland. Registered in 1926 by Hans Wilsdorf, founder of Rolex, the brand remains a sister company to Rolex; both companies are owned by the Hans Wilsdorf Foundation. Tudor was initially known for watches produced for the military and professional divers.

In 1946, the founder of Rolex, Hans Wilsdorf, created the company Montres TUDOR SA to offer watches with the quality and dependability of a Rolex at a more accessible price point. Esthetics and performance for the most demanding of products, designed for endurance as much as pleasure. Its screw-down waterproof case back is inscribed "Montres TUDOR S.A. Geneva Switzerland Patented" on the inside. On the outside, the case back is engraved "Original Oyster Case by Rolex Geneva". The self-winding movement with date and day mechanisms is A.S. Calibre 1895. The rotor is signed "TUDOR AUTO-PRINCE SWISS MADE". On 6 March 1946, he created "Montres TUDOR S.A.", specializing in models for both men and women. Rolex would guarantee the technical, aesthetic, and functional characteristics, along with the distribution and after-sales service. TUDOR History. HANS WILSDORF'S INTUITION
